Fees for financial advisors

Financial advisors usually charge about 1% for the total assets under management. Fees charged for services can vary widely depending on their nature. There are many advisors who charge flat fees, while others may charge hourly. It is important to fully understand the fees charged and how they are calculated before you hire a financial advisor. The fees for investment can range between 1% and 3% per calendar year, and they are generally passed along to investors.


A financial planner will normally charge a fixed rate for creating a financial strategy. This will either be paid in one lump sum payment or in monthly installments. If the client has an ongoing relationship with the financial planner, the fees may be less. Other fee structures may include commissions for the sale of products or services or hourly rates. It is important to understand the fees that financial advisors charge. This will allow you to get a good deal. By educating yourself on fees, you will know exactly what you can expect and negotiate the fee that is right for you.

Financial advisors earn commissions

Investment advisors are paid commissions when their clients purchase products from them. These commissions are typically in the form a percentage of the sale price and sometimes are based upon the advisor's relationship to a company. Commissions are not limited to investment products. Insurance products, for instance, can carry huge incentives. Some advisors make as much as 70%, while others earn as high as 5%.

While commissions may not pose a problem over the long term, they can lead to conflicts of interest for advisors who are motivated by their own profit to trade aggressively. Advisors who receive excessive commissions may be tempted recommend products that make them the most money, even though they might not be the best for their clients. There are solutions to this problem. One way to reduce advisor commissions is to limit the products that they can sell.
